Exceptional Lives: Special Education in Today's Schools, Student Value Edition (7th Edition)


Through real-life stories about children, their families, and their teachers, and through the use of the most recent evidence-based research on special education, this important book provides a comprehensive introduction to special education and its relationship to general education.
